Dutch own around €3 billion in cryptocurrency

Approximately 400 thousand Dutch own cryptocurrency, according to a study by Maurice de Hond. In total they own around 3 billion euros worth of these digital coins, the Telegraaf reports.

De Hond, of polling site Peil.nl, investigated Dutch interest in c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um in the run-up to the Day of the Crypto at RAI in Amsterdam on Monday and Tuesday. According to De Hond, interest in cryptocurrency is growing strongly in the Netherlands, showing a significant spike in November and December. The pollster adds that while 3 billion euros is a lot of money, it is only a pittance compared to the Dutch's total wealth. It is less than 1 percent of the total 350 billion euros the Dutch have in savings.

Whether these figures are completely accurate is not clear. Cryptocurrencies do not fall under the control of Dutch regulators like financial markets authority AFM or central bank DNB, and gaining insight into the cryptocurrency world can be difficult.

Earlier this week the Tweede Kamer, the lower house of Dutch parliament, debated cryptocurrency with the Dutch regulators and experts in the field. All agreed that this new sector needs to be regulated, though how to do so is still a matter of discussion.
